Zeus Expands Catheter Manufacturing with New CathX Medical Facility in Costa Rica

New Cartago facility will expand CathX Medical’s manufacturing footprint and create local jobs, advancing its integrated development-to-production model

ORANGEBURG, S.C., August 13, 2026 Zeus, the global leader in advanced polymer solutions and a provider of contract manufacturing for catheter sub-assemblies, today announced that its CathX Medical business has signed a lease for a new catheter manufacturing facility in the La Lima Free Zone in Cartago, Costa Rica. The investment expands CathX Medical’s manufacturing capacity to support customer programs as they grow, while continuing development and early production at its existing U.S. operations.

The Costa Rica facility complements CathX Medical’s sites in San Jose, California, and Arden Hills, Minnesota, and advances the company’s three-site model: new products are developed and built in low volumes in the U.S., and Costa Rica supports commercial-scale manufacturing as those programs mature, all under the same quality management system, equipment, and tooling. The site will initially focus on catheter sub-assembly operations, with the same processes and quality standards customers rely on today.

Costa Rica is a globally recognized hub for medical device manufacturing, with a highly skilled workforce, strong infrastructure, and a well-established free trade zone system. The La Lima location positions CathX Medical alongside many of its customers, supporting faster scale-up and greater supply chain resilience. CathX Medical leases the facility with long-term renewal rights and the option to expand within the park as the business grows.

The facility is now in its build-out and hiring phase, with operational readiness expected in Q2 2027 following equipment installation, validation, and workforce onboarding. CathX Medical expects to hire 100 team members in Costa Rica over the next 12 to 18 months, including positions in engineering, technical, and manufacturing operations. The company is particularly seeking candidates with knowledge and experience in extrusion, braiding, and complex catheter assembly processes.

The facility will meet all applicable regulatory and quality requirements, including ISO 13485 certification and FDA registration, prior to production.
